Bob Massie (pictured) holds the Australian record for the best bowling figures in a Test match with 16/137 taken in the second Test of the 1972 Ashes series. Australia's Charles Bannerman was the first cricketer to score a century on Test debut, in the first Test match.. During 8 ICC World Twenty20 tournaments, Australia's best performance came during 2021, where they beat New Zealand to lift their first T20I World Cup.
